When I was a new streamer I got myself an Elgato Stream Deck, and Immediately got to making the BEST setup I could for my stream deck. I quickly found out that the stream decks folders were a mess and made this solution to help!
With this setup for your stream deck, you can add more button than you could ever ask for! This Hotbar Techinue for stream decks is unlike any other I have seen and it truly adds more value to the stream deck. If your new to streaming, or have been streaming for years, this hotbar could add so much more production quality for your streams.
Having the ability to add music, sound effects, scenes, sources, filters, visual effects, CTA's, open programs, and so more much, all within just two clicks makes everything you do that much more efficant!

Basically a permanent hotbar allows you to essentially reach any of the potential 190+buttons to be accessed in just two clicks, one to the hot bar and one to the button wanted. Folders do work but as someone who has 50+ sound effects as well as screen effects and changes, a hotbar works much faster and stream lined for production purposes
